Historical Events on April 27

Here is a list of some events happened on April 27. For full list please click on the link above.

Date Event
1911 Following the resignation and death of William P. Frye, a compromise is reached to rotate the office of President pro tempore of the United States Senate.
1978 The Saur Revolution begins in Afghanistan, ending the following morning with the murder of Afghan President Mohammed Daoud Khan and the establishment of the Democratic Republic of Afghanistan.[6]
1595 The relics of Saint Sava are incinerated in Belgrade on the Vračar plateau by Ottoman Grand Vizier Sinan Pasha; the site of the incineration is now the location of the Church of Saint Sava, one of the largest Orthodox churches in the world
1565 Cebu is established becoming the first Spanish settlement in the Philippines.
1981 Xerox PARC introduces the computer mouse.
1861 American President Abraham Lincoln suspends the writ of habeas corpus.
1986 The city of Pripyat and surrounding areas are evacuated due to Chernobyl disaster.
1945 World War II: The last German formations withdraw from Finland to Norway. The Lapland War and thus, World War II in Finland, comes to an end and the Raising the Flag on the Three-Country Cairn photograph is taken.
1967 Expo 67 officially opens in Montreal, Quebec, Canada with a large opening ceremony broadcast around the world. It opens to the public the next day.
1813 War of 1812: American troops capture York, the capital of Upper Canada, in the Battle of York.
